WebThe most common type of tongue cancer is squamous cell carcinoma (SCC). Squamous cells are the flat, skin like cells that cover the lining of the mouth, nose, larynx, thyroid and throat. Squamous cell carcinoma is the name for a cancer that starts in these cells. WebThe tongue is involved in more than 50% of OSCCs [1, 2]. Although OSCCs may frequently metastasize to regional areas, distant metastasis—especially secondary involvement of the myocardium—is extremely rare. Most of these cases are generally diagnosed only at autopsy given that many patients are asymptomatic at the time of initial diagnosis.
